Philip Coggan, the Capital Markets Editor of The Economist joins us to talk about his special report on Pensions. Things have changed quite a bit since the first pension scheme was introduced by Otto Von Bismarck back in the 19th century. As people in developed countries are living longer, the pressure on the working population is mounting steadily to support the greying economies. In this podcast, Philip suggests different ways to tackle this problem by citing examples of governments which are doing it right and a few others which aren't.
